The Unique Process of Snail Reproduction

Snails, like many invertebrates, possess a fascinating and unique approach to reproduction that distinguishes them from other members of the animal kingdom. Unlike mammals, which segregate genders, most snails species are hermaphrodites, meaning each snail has both male and female reproductive organs. This setup allows them to carry out both roles in the reproduction process and makes the act of reproduction a lot more flexible. The hermaphroditic nature greatly increases their chances of successful reproduction, since any encounter with another member of the same species could potentially result in offspring.

The Mate Selection Strategy in Snails

Mate selection in snails is an intricate process. Contrary to what might be expected from hermaphrodites, snails do not usually self-fertilize. They strive to find a mate by using pheromones and touch. Once a potential mate is identified, snails will circle one another and exchange fertilizing fluid via a body structure known as a love dart. This courtship process can take hours, and even after this, a snail may decide to reject the encounter if the potential mate is not found suitable.

The Egg-Laying Process and Factors Influencing It

After a successful mating, snails lay eggs. Depending on the species, an individual snail can lay anywhere from 30 to 120 eggs at once. The eggs are typically buried in top soil or deposited in a nest, where they will develop and hatch after a few weeks to several months. Both the number of eggs laid and the speed at which they develop are greatly influenced by environmental conditions such as temperature and humidity.

Challenges and Threats to Snail Reproduction

Impact of Environmental Changes

Environmental factors play a key role in the reproduction process of snails. Changes in temperature and humidity can greatly affect the number of eggs laid and the speed of their development. Given that a significant number of snail species are endemic and flourish in very specific habitats, changes in the environmental conditions can potentially threaten the reproduction process and, by extension, the survival of the species.

Threats from Predators and Pests

Predators and pests pose significant threats to snail reproduction. Birds, mammals, and insects are all predatorial threats to snails and their eggs. Moreover, parasites and diseases can destroy whole populations of snails, impacting not only their immediate survival but their overall reproductive success. Hence, maintaining a safe and healthy environment is critical for successful snail reproduction.

Impact of Human Activities

Human activities often pose significant threats to the reproductive success of snails. Habitat destruction, pollution, and climate change are all human-induced factors that have a drastic impact on snail populations. Urban development often leads to habitat destruction, while pollution from pesticides can harm both adult snails and their eggs. Climate change, on the other hand, can lead to changes in environmental conditions such as temperature and humidity levels, which directly affect snail reproduction.
